Chicago: Concealed Carry Permit Holder Shoots Alleged Carjacker

December 9, 2025
in Americas

In a shocking turn of events in the bustling city of Chicago, a concealed carry permit holder took matters into their own hands and opened fire on two alleged carjackers on Monday morning. The incident occurred in the Lawndale neighborhood on the west side of the city. According to authorities, the concealed carry permit holder wounded one of the suspects before they could carry out their crime.

The incident, although unfortunate, serves as a powerful reminder of the importance of the Second Amendment and the right to bear arms. It also highlights the effectiveness of responsible gun ownership and the role it plays in keeping our communities safe.

Details of the incident are still emerging, but it is reported that the concealed carry permit holder was approached by two individuals who demanded their vehicle at gunpoint. Without hesitation, the permit holder drew their weapon and fired, injuring one of the suspects and causing the other to flee the scene. The wounded suspect was later apprehended by the police and charged with attempted robbery.

The quick and decisive action of the concealed carry permit holder undoubtedly prevented a potentially dangerous situation from escalating. It is a testament to the effectiveness of concealed carry laws, allowing law-abiding citizens to defend themselves and others from harm.

Unfortunately, Chicago has been plagued by carjacking incidents in recent years, making it one of the most dangerous cities for car theft in the country. In 2020 alone, there were over 1,400 carjackings reported in the city, a staggering 135% increase from the previous year. It is a concerning trend that has left citizens feeling vulnerable and in need of protection.
